


A handful of the game's UI fonts seem to scale incredibly low-res at the Deck's 800p resolution, but nothing that makes the game unplayable. Namely the charge number in the top left, and the titles when entering an area are lower resolution than what I saw on my desktop.
No performance issues whatsoever, you can even raise the cap up to 90 FPS if you want the camera to feel smoother at the cost of battery (around 14-15 watts). In most cases, the game ran perfectly, however on occasion the steamdeck's controller would not be properly recognised, often after switching from docked using a wireless controller, only accepting mouse input via the trackpad. Double checking and fixing the controller order usually fixed it (The steam deck's controller would often be listed as number 2 in controller order, dispite no other controllers being attachted at the time), Otherwise relaunching the game until it resolved itself was necessary.

Text seems to be linked to Resolution so it is blurry or just not readable. Text boxes are however fully legible
Defaults to 1280x720. Setting to 1920x1080 sets it to 1280x800 for some reason

Keep it borderless, exclusive seems to be a little buggy and shrinks the game a bit.

The game ran great, and even has an in-game framerate limiter that goes as low as 30FPS. Should work nicely with the refresh rate performance setting.
